Pakistan, July 16 -- The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) has launched a comprehensive three-tier departmental cricket structure for the 2025-26 domestic season, which is scheduled to take place from August 2025 to May 2026.
This newly introduced framework replaces the previous two-tier model and features over 40 departments from across the country.
Teams have been categorised into Grade-I, Grade-II, and the newly introduced Grade-III, creating a merit-based system with promotion and relegation across the tiers.
New competitive format
